Alabama Driver’s License Change of Address Process Made Easier

MONTGOMERY, ALABAMA – Residents of Alabama who need to update their driver’s license with a change of address now have a much easier process thanks to recent updates in the Alabama Department of Public Safety system.

In the past, changing your address on your driver’s license in Alabama could be a tedious and time-consuming task, requiring a visit to the local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) office and filling out paperwork in person. However, a new online system now allows Alabama residents to update their address on their driver’s license from the comfort of their own home.

The online system, which was launched earlier this year, allows Alabama residents to log onto the Alabama Department of Public Safety website and update their address with just a few clicks. To use the system, residents simply need to input their current driver’s license information and their new address. Once the information has been verified, residents can pay a small processing fee and receive a new driver’s license with their updated address in the mail.
